I'm replacing my PC and wondering whether to go to Vista at the same time. I've tracked down Vista drivers for everything I need, except my Minolta Scan-Multi Pro film scanner. Anyone know if this is going to be possible? If I can't use the scanner on it I'll simply have to have XP on the new box instead, but for other reasons would like to use Vista if I can. Thanks, Peter |

I installed my HP 5490C scanner under Vista using the XP drivers that HP says will not work under Vista. Well, it works for me. Try the XP drivers. They may work, not withstanding that perhaps they are not supposed to. |
